New Mobile Internet Post

Mobile Internet is our day job over at Mobile Internet Resource Center (MIRC), but we do enjoy continuing to share about our personal setup here on the blog – as we have since the very beginning.

We just put out a brand new video showcasing our van’s mobile internet setup that features Starlink and two cellular embedded routers from Pepwave. We have one very connected van:

 

We’ve also updated our personal mobile internet setup page with all of the latest gear & data plans we’re using for both van and boat (I was planning a major new updated post on the topic.. but with comments down, we’ll get to that later):

Technomadia’s Personal Mobile Internet Setup

A lot of has changed in mobile internet since our last major personal post on the topic a year ago – in which we updated then on the state of 5G and Starlink (we advised holding off back then).

In the last two months, Starlink has become much more feasible for RV and boat portable use – with them enabling roaming. This allows you to use Starlink at locations away from your registered service address. Coverage is now nationwide as well – even covering Mexico and the southern parts of Canada. And for those who don’t necessarily have a fixed location they want to use service at – ordering Starlink without a long wait is possible too.

Some of our initial concerns remain however – it’s not perfect for everything. Obstructions, congestion, drop outs and slower than ideal upload speeds means we still supplement with cellular data.
